Você está na página 1de 9

Introduo ao Fractal

Sadao Massago
Outubro de 2010

Nota
Este o trabalho apresentado no VII Semana Acadmica de Matemtica, realizado
no perodo de 27 de setembro de 2010 a 1o.

de outubro de 2010, na Universidade

Federal de Tocantins, Campus de Araguana.

Resumo
Apesar de ainda no existir nenhuma caracterizao exata do conjunto fractal, a ideia
intuitiva o conjunto na qual contm uma cpia reduzida de si mesmo, podendo ou
no ser acompanhado de deformaes. Alguns destes conjuntos podem ser construdos
para servir de exemplos do problema matemtico, enquanto que outros aparecem naturalmente no estudo de alguns problemas. Recentemente o Mandelbrot constatou que
a estrutura fractal aparece frequentemente na natureza, deixando de ser interesse no
apenas dos matemticos. Neste texto ser apresentado somente os conceitos bsicos,
mas sem muito formalismo para evitar o uso de conceitos da matemtica avanada
necessrio para estudo dos fractais.

Palavras-chave: fractal, IFS

Introduo

A ideia por traz do conjunto fractal o auto similaridade, isto , o conjunto na qual
a parte dele uma miniatura do conjunto todo. Vejamos o exemplo do tringulo de
Sierpinski (Figura 1). Ele formado pelas trs cpias do tringulo, cada um situado
em um canto do tringulo original.
pela escala de

Cada cpia exatamente a reduo do original

1/2.

Quando o conjunto exatamente a unio das cpias reduzidas dele mesmo, dizemos que o conjunto exatamente auto similar. No entanto, fractal no precisam ser

exatamente auto similar. Os fractais construdos so comportados, mas os que surgem


no estudo de outros problemas costuma ser complexas.

Por exemplo, o conjunto de

Mandelbrot (Figura 2 a esquerda) contm muitas cpias reduzidas (Figura 2 no centro


uma ampliao de ponto quase invisvel da ponta esquerda) com ou sem deformaes, mas tambm contm muitos outraos fractais (Figura 2 a esquerda m ampliao
de onde esfera gruda no cardioide).
Em 1872, O Karl Weierstrass construiu um exemplo abstrato de uma funo contnua que no diferencivel em todos os pontos. Em 1904, o Helge von Koch construiu
uma curva fractal que reproduz a funo similar, denominado de curva de Koch. Em
1915, Waclaw Sierpinski construiu o triangulo de Sierpinski.

Maioria destes conjun-

tos auto similares foram construidos para obter exemplos de problemas complexos da
matemtica.
Nos sculos 19 e 20, foram estudados iterao das funes no plano complexo (Henri
Poincar, Felix Klein, Pierre Fatou e Gaston Julia), mas ainda no tinha recursos
computacionais que permitiria a visualizao da estrutura fractal associada (veja [9]
para mais detalhes).
Na dcada de 1960, o Benoit Mandelbrot inicia a investigao do conjunto auto
similar (ver [5]) e a partir de 1975, usa o termo fractal (quebrado ou fraturado em
latin) para designar o conjunto na qual a dimenso de HausdorBesicovitch maior
do que a dimenso topolgica. O Mandelbrot podia visualizou o conjunto com o uso
de computador e percebeu que um conjunto auto similar muito complexa. Tambm
foi o Mandelbrot que chamou a ateno pelo fato de ter estrutura fractal na natureza
(ver [5] e [6]).
Curiosamente, nem a denio do Mandelbrot, nem a denio posterior determina exatamente o conjunto que queramos considerar como sendo fractal (veja [4]).
Em outros termos, ainda no sabemos o que caracteriza exatamente o conjunto fractal. Apesar de ter outros tipos de conjuntos auto similares, ns concentraremos nos
conjuntos fractais do tipo exatamente auto similar ou quase auto similar.

Exitem vrios softwares livres para desenhar fractais, tais como fraqtive (http://fraqtive.mimec.org
e GNU XaoS (http://xaos.sourceforge.net/) especializado nos conjuntos de Julia e

Figura 1: Tringulo de Sierpinski

Figura 2: Conjunto de Mandelbrot

de Mandelbrot e gnofract4d (http://gnofract4d.sourceforge.net/) e clssico FractInt


(http://spanky.triumf.ca/www/fractint/fractint.html) para fractais diversos.

Dimenso Fractal

Um fractal pode ser associado a medida de similaridade denominado de dimenso


fractal. O estudo de dimenses muito complexa, mas no caso de ser exatamente auto
similar, podemos obter o seu valor.
Dizemos que um conjunto

n1 (X)

onde

i (X)

exatamente auto similar quando

so cpias reduzidas exatas de

X = 0 (X)

(sem deformao). No caso do

tringulo de Sierpinski (Figura 1), ele formado por trs cpias reduzidas por escala de

1/2
1/2

(distncia reduzido a
do conjunto

X,

1/2).

Assim,

i (X)

so exatamente as redues na escala

seguido de uma translao adequada.

Para denir a dimenso fractal, precisamos saber o que uma dimenso no caso
geral. Quando existe uma distncia, dizemos que um conjunto foi escalado pelo fator

quando a distncia entre os pontos for multiplicado exatamente por

conjunto for escalado por

o comprimento ser multiplicado por

a rea ser multiplicado por


por

Quando um

no caso de curvas,

no caso de superfcies e o volume, ser multiplicado

no caso de slidos. A medida dito de dimenso

quando efetuar escalonamento por

se for multiplicado por

Assim, comprimento, rea e volumes so medidas

1, 2 e 3 respectivamente. Formalmente, dizemos que uma medida md de


d
dimenso d quando md ( X) = md (X) se X for conjunto X escalado por > 0.
Agora vamos supor que X = 0 (X) n1 (X) onde i (X) so cpias de
X com a escala i > 0 e que essas cpias tenham interseces vazias ou que sejam
nmero nito de pontos. Ento a medida de dimenso d deve satisfazer md (X) =

md (0 (X) n1 (X)) = d0 md (X) + + dn1 md (X) = d0 + + dn1 md (X),
pois a medida do conjunto nito de pontos nula para d > 0. Se md (X) existir, for
d
d
nito e no nulo, temos a equao 1 = 0 + + n1 , cuja soluo d a dimenso
fractal. Observe que no caso de ter algum i 1, a equao no teria soluo positiva,
de dimenso

mas se

i, i < 1,

existe uma nica soluo. Note que a equao foi obtida, supondo

que existe uma medida de dimenso

d>0

na qual o conjunto tem medida no nula e

limitada na qual no fcil de provar.


O caso especial na qual todas as cpias tem a mesma escala (

= i ),

podemos

1 = nn . Aplicando logaritmos em ambos lados, isoln n


que permite calcular a dimenso fractal
temos d =
ln(1/)

resolver a equao como sendo


lando o

e simplicando,

para o caso do conjunto exatamente auto similar cuja todas cpias tem o mesmo fator
de escala.

X = 0 (X) 1 (X) 2 (X) onde


1/2. ALogo, n = 3 e = 1/2, tendo

No caso do tringulo de Sierpinski (Figura 1),

i (X) uma reduo

= 1.584962500721156.

cada cpia

d=

ln 3
ln(2)

por escala de

Muitos dos fractais costumam ter dimenso no inteiras, mas existem fractais com
dimenso inteira. Para estudos de dimenses, veja o [3].

Mtodo da Contagem de Caixas

Exceto nos casos de fractais exatamente auto similares, no simples de obter a dimenso fractal. Para ter um valor aproximado, podemos usar o processo de contagem
de caixas.
Inicialmente, desenhamos um retngulo contendo o conjunto fractal de forma que
o conjunto toquem cada um dos lados.
partes iguais, obtendo

k2

Subdividimos cada lado do retngulo em

retngulos semelhantes, Seja

que interceptam o conjunto

dk =
d = lim dk

e calculamos

ln nk
.
ln k

nk ,

o nmero de retngulos

Quando o conjunto satisfaz

onde d a dimenso fractal. Na


k
prtica, difcil obter imagens de alta resoluo exceto nos casos associados ao problema

certas condies, podemos provar que

matemtico, alm dos objetos da natureza costumam ter dimenso fractal diferente em
cada intervalo de escala. Para melhorar a estimativa em tais condies, a anlise de
dados costumam ser aplicadas sobre

dk .

IFS (Sistema Iterativa de Funes)

Quando um conjunto formado pelas cpias reduzidas com deformaes controladas,


podemos obter a funo que efetua tais redues e deformaes na qual servir para
reconstruir o conjunto todo. A funo que determina a cpia denominada de funo
de similaridade.

: Rn Rn denominado de
X, Y Rn , k(X) (Y )k k{k X Y }.

Uma aplicao
que

contrao quando existe

<1

tal

Dado um conjunto de contraes


que

F = 1 (F ) n (F ).

{1 , . . . , n },

podemos analisar o conjunto

tal

possvel mostrar que existe um nico conjunto deste

Rn ). Para aplicaes
prticas, costumam usar contraes sejam as aplicaes ans, isto , i (X) = AX +B
onde A uma matriz quadrada n n e B um vetor n dimensional. Toda combinao
tipo e compacto (limitado e fechado no caso do subconjunto de

da mudana de escala, rotao, reexo e translaes podem ser representados pelas


aplicaes ans.
Como exemplo, vamos obter o IFS associado ao tringulo de Sierpinski.
um dos trs tringulos so exatamente a reduo por escala de

1 (x, y) =
"
#" # "
1
0
x
3 (x, y) = 2 1
+
0 2
y

posio do vrtice do canto esquerdo inferior, veremos que

"

1
2

#"

"

Analisando a
#" #
1
0
x
2
,
1
0 2
y
#

1
4
.
3
0
0 12
4
Um dos algoritmos mais simples para produzir a imagem do conjunto fractal asso-

2 (x, y) =

x
y

1
2

1/2".

Cada

ciado ao IFS o mtodo de Chaos Game.

Algortmo Chaos Game para {0 , . . . , n1 }


Escolha o ponto inicial x0
x = x0
para i = 0 . . . N0
k = nmero sorteado entre 0 e n 1
x = k (x)
fim para
para i = N0 . . . [Iterao mxima]
k = nmero sorteado entre 0 e n 1
x = k (x)
desenhe o ponto x
fim para
fim algortmo
O mtodo de Chaos Game baseado no teorema relacionado ao conjunto atrator do
sistema dinmico determinado pelas funes

{0 , . . . , n1 }

na qual no vamos entrar

em detalhes. os interessados podem consultar referncias tais como [8, 7, 3]).

Onde aparece os fractais?

O conjunto fractal aparecem tanto no estudo dos problemas matemticos, como no


problemas relacionado aos estudos na natureza.

5.1

Objetos na Natureza

Muitos objetos da natureza tem a estrutura recursiva e podem manter a dimenso


fractal at uma escala considervel.

Os exemplos mais comuns so:

costas e rios,

superfcies dos planetas, fraturas, rvores e outras plantas, veias, texturas do solo, etc.
Para analisar tais objetos, costumam calcular a dimenso fractal e no caso de reconstruo, tentar determinar o IFS aproximado. Note que as tcnicas de Curvas de
Koch e L-system (sobre L-systens, veja [1]) so casos especiais de IFS.
O estudo da transmisso de sinais tambm envolve fractal como o estudo feito pelo
Mandelbrot ou da antena fractal comumente utilizada nos celulares e outros receptores
de sinais.

5.2

Exemplos Matemticos

Os fractais so teis para obter diversos exemplos interessantes de matemtica. Veremos algumas delas. Para mais exemplos, veja [7].

O conjunto de Cantor
O processo de obter o Conjunto de Cantor remover um tero central do segmento.

1/3.

Na primeira etapa, sobra dois segmentos de tamanho


de cada um deles, sobra
de tamanho

segmentos de tamanho

1/3

Removendo um tero central

. Na etapa

n, sobra 2n segmentos

1/3n .

1 segmento substituido por 2

4 iteraes

Figura 3: Conjunto de Cantor

O conjunto de Cantor um conjunto no enumervel, tem medida nula e no


denso em nenhum ponto. Como ele formado pelas duas cpias com escala de
sua dimenso

d=

ln 2
ln 3

1/3,

= 0.63092975357146.

Curvas de Koch
Na curva do Koch, um segmento substitudo por segmento poligonal formado

por

segmentos de tamanho

dos segmentos. Na etapa

1/3

n,

1/3.

O processo aplicado indenidamente em cada um

ter uma linha poligonal com

4n

segmentos de tamanho

. Esta curva contnua, mas no tem derivadas em nenhum ponto. Um tringulo

formado pelas trs curvas de Koch denominado de oco de neve de Koch e delimita
uma regio nita, apesar de ter permetro innito.
A curva de Koch formado pelas 4 cpias com reduo de

d=

ln 4
ln 3

= 1.261859507142915.
6

1/3.

Logo a sua dimenso

4 iteraes

linha poligonal que substituir o segmento


Figura 4: Curvas de Koch

Curvas de Peano
Apesar da imagem da curva de Peano ser um quadrado e no um fractal, a construo consiste no processo de auto similaridade exata. Um segmento que diagonal
de um quadrado ser substitudo pelas linhas poligonais como mostrado na Figura 5.
O limite deste processo gera uma funo contnua e bijetiva do intervalo no quadrado.
isto ilustra que a imagem da funo contnua de um conjunto sem rea pode ter rea.
Note que nos estudos relacionados s medidas, ter derivada contnua importante para
usar o Teorema de Sarge.

4
3

9
8

5
2
1

linha poligonal que substituir o segmento

2 iteraes

Figura 5: Processo de construo da Curva de Peano

Como um segmento (diagonal) substitudo pelos

1/3,
5.3

sua dimenso

d=

ln 32
ln 3

2 ln 3
ln 3

diagonais de escala reduzida a

= 2.

Conjunto Fractal no sistema dinmico

Quando estuda o comportamento das funes, a sua representao grca pode ter uma
estrutura fractal como no caso do conjunto de Mandelbrot (Figura_2).

O conjunto

de Mandelbrot um mapeamento do comportamento de divergncia da sequncia


associada na qual no vamos entrar em detalhes. No caso do estudo do comportamento
das equaes diferenciais, costuma aparecer tambm o conjunto denominado de chaos
na qual no apresenta propriedades de auto similaridade, o que complica mais ainda o
seu estudo.
Consideremos somente o caso do sistema dinmico associado ao estudo da iterao
das funes.
Dada uma funo

: Rn Rn

e um ponto

x0 R n ,

podemos criar uma sequncia

de forma recursiva, denindo


da funo

(z) = z + c

xn+1 = (xn )

para

O Julia considerou o caso

no plano complexo e estudou o comportamento da sequncia

associada. O contorno da regio onde seus pontos


innito no sentido de

n > 0.

|xn |

x0

gera uma sequncia que tende a

costuma ser um fractal, denominado de conjunto de

Julia.

Figura 6: Fractal de Julia de

O Mandelbrot xou

(z) = z 2 + 0.25

x0 = 0 e analisou o comportamento em relao ao parmetro c.

Dada famlia de funes a um parmetro, o contorno do conjunto de parmetros na qual


a sequncia recursiva associada uma sequncia que tende a innito (|xn |
um fractal denominado de Conjunto de Mandelbrot. A Figura 2 o

z 2 + c.

) forma
caso de c (z) =

Os fractais do tipo Julia ou Mandelbrot costuma ter estruturas complexas,

mesmo no caso das funes mais simples, o que torna difcil de ser estudados.

Os

interessados podem consultar o [2].

5.4

IFS Como Sistema Dinmicos

Para estudar o IFS, necessrio analisar como um sistema dinmico.

Em vez de

analisar se a sequncia tende a innito, tambm podemos analisar se a sequncia tende


a algum conjunto limitado.

: X X , dizemos que F um atrator quando, para todo


x0 , a sequ6encia recursiva xn+1 = (xn ) associado tende ao conjunto F , isto , torna
cada vez mais prximo de F . No caso de ser uma contrao, o teorema de Picard
garante que existe um nico ponto xo (logo, F composto de um nico ponto). Caso
de ter vrias contraes como no caso de IFS, o conjunto atrator F costuma ser um
conjunto compacto satisfazendo F = 0 (F ) n1 (F ) que um conjunto auto
Dado uma aplicao

similar (fractal). Como a regra de similaridade so as contraes usadas, o problema


pode ser estudado mais facilmente do que outros tipos de fractais.

Por exemplo, a

demonstrao da funcionalidade do Chaos Game no ser difcil.

Referncias
[1] Barngley, Michael et. al., The Science of Fractal Images, SpringerVerlag, 1988.

[2] Devaney, Robert L., Introduction to Chaotic Dynamical Systems, second edition, Addison-Wesley, 1989.
[3] Edgar, Gerald, "Measure, Topology, and Fractal Geometry", Second Edition , Springer, 2008.
[4] Falconer, Kennet J., Fractal Geometry (Mathematical Foundations and
Applications), second edition, John Wiley & Sons Ltd., 2003.
[5] Mandelbrot, Benot, How Long Is the Coast of Britain? Statistical SelfSimilarity and Fractional Dimension, Science, New Series, 1967, Vol.
156, No. 3775, pp. 636-638.
[6] Mandelbrot, Benoit, The Fractal Geometry of Nature, W. H. Freeman
and Company, 1982.
[7] Sagan, Hang, Space Filling Curves, Springer-Verlag, 1994.
[8] Vicsec, Tams, Fractal Growyh Phenomena, World Scientic, 1989.
[9] Disponvel em <http://en.wikipedia.org/wiki/Fractal>, consultado em
09 de setembro de 2010.

Você também pode gostar